#094409 color RGB value is (9,68,9). #094409 color name is Custom Color color.

#094409 hex color red value is 9, green value is 68 and the blue value of its RGB is 9.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#094409 hue: 0.33, saturation: 0.77 and the lightness value of 094409 is 0.15.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#094409 color hex is 0.87, 0.00, 0.87, 0.73. Web safe color of #094409 is #003300. Color #094409 contains mainly GREEN color.

About #094409 Custom Color

#094409 (Custom Color) is a green-based color with RGB values of 9, 68, 9. This color belongs to the green color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#094409,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#094409 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#094409), RGB (rgb(9, 68, 9)), HSL (hsl(120, 77%, 15%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#003300,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
